Practical workflow
Use even light and leave visible contrast between the item and its original background.
Zoom around lace, wire, fringe, handles, and translucent packaging; restore any detail the model missed.
Save a transparent PNG, then reuse it on backgrounds that match your shop identity.
Field guide
Background removal improves consistency, but it cannot recreate detail hidden by blur or harsh shadows. A sharp source photo with soft, even light gives the edge model more information to work with.
Keep honest product colour and scale. The cutout should make the listing easier to understand, not conceal wear, texture, or material details that a buyer needs to judge the item.
